CAREER (through 2007 season): Quick defensive lineman who has made the transition from tackle to end…spent the entire season on the 53-man active roster for the first time in his career in 2008…appeared in a career-high 14 games last season, posting four sacks to finish second on the team.
2008 (Houston 14/0): Played in 14 games…posted 17 total tackles, one fumble recovery and four sacks, which was good for second on the team behind DE Mario Williams…inactive at Pittsburgh (9/7)…played at defensive tackle and on special teams, but did not record a tackle at Tennessee (9/21)…inactive at Jacksonville (9/28)…played at defensive tackle and on special teams vs. Indianapolis (10/5)…finished the game with four total tackles…contributed at defensive tackle and on special teams vs. Miami (10/12) and registered two quarterback hurries…played at defensive tackle and on special teams vs. Detroit (10/19) and recorded the first sack of his career in the fourth quarter…played at defensive end and on special teams vs. Cincinnati (10/26) and posted two tackles and one quarterback hurry…played at defensive tackle, where he recorded his second sack of the season, at Minnesota (11/2)…played at defensive tackle and registered two tackles, including his third sack of the season, vs. Baltimore (11/9)…recorded a sack in back-to-back games for the first time in his career…posted two solo tackles at Indianapolis (11/16)…recorded one solo tackle at Cleveland (11/23)…played at defensive tackle and on special teams vs. Jacksonville (12/1) and registered one quarterback hurry…posted two total tackles, including his fourth sack of the season, in the second quarter at Green Bay (12/7)…pounced on a fumble by Titans WR Justin McCareins in the second quarter to make his first career fumble recovery vs. Tennessee (12/14)…played at defensive tackle and recorded one assist at Oakland (12/21)…played at defensive end and on special teams vs. Chicago (12/28).
2007 (Houston 2/0): Spent the majority of the season on the Texans practice squad before being signed to the 53-man roster for the last two games of the season…saw his first game action since 2005 at Indianapolis (12/23) and recorded one solo tackle…made one solo stop in the season finale vs. Jacksonville (12/30).
 
2006 (Houston 0/0): Joined the Texans midway through the season…member of the practice squad until late December…inactive for final two games against Indianapolis (12/24) and Cleveland (12/31).
 
2005 (Arizona 8/1): As a rookie free agent, attended training camp with the Cards before being released (9/3)…signed to the practice squad (9/4)…promoted from the practice squad after injuries decimated the defensive line (11/8)…made his NFL debut at Detroit (11/13)…recorded his first career tackles vs. Washington (12/11)…recorded two tackles for a loss at Houston (12/18)…saw extended playing time against Philadelphia (12/24) while earning a start; recorded five tackles including two for a loss…recorded one pass defensed at Indianapolis (1/1).

In 49 games for Boston College, started 21 times…produced 160 tackles (111 solos) with 10.5 sacks for minus-40 yards, 38 stops for losses of 115 yards and 36 quarterback pressures…caused and recovered two fumbles, blocked a kick and batted away 17 passes…All-Big East Conference second-team choice as a senior in 2004.

Signed as undrafted free agent by the Arizona Cardinals on April 25, 2005…released by Cardinals on Sept. 3, 2005…signed by Cardinals to practice squad on Sept. 4, 2005…signed to active roster on Nov. 8, 2005…re-signed by Cardinals on April 3, 2006…released by Cardinals on Sept. 2, 2006…signed to Houston Texans practice squad on Oct. 10, 2006…activated from Texans' practice squad on Dec. 23, 2006…released by Texans on Sept. 1, 2008…re-signed to Texans' practice squad on Sept. 3, 2008...activated from Texans' practice squad on Dec. 19, 2008.

Attended Boston College (Dorchester, Mass.) High School…Super Prep All-American pick as a senior defensive tackle for the Eagles…Boston Globe Division I Player of the Year in 2000 and captured Catholic Conference MVP honors that season…two-time Catholic Conference All-Star and selected as an Eastern Massachusetts Division I All- Star…recorded 17.0 sacks in his senior season and finished his career with 36.5 sacks in three seasons, while serving as team captain as a senior…brother, Andrew, was a defensive tackle at Kansas State (2003-05).
